Power over Ethernet podcast

27 Mar 2006 | Jeff Kelly & Kara Gattine

Digg This!    StumbleUpon Toolbar StumbleUpon    Bookmark with Delicious Del.icio.us   

In this podcast, we'll discusses the emergence of Power over Ethernet and its many benefits to enterprise networks. We'll also include some expert comments about the technology from The Siemon Company's Carrie Higbie and Sam Bottros of Cisco Systems.
